The Real Story of Twilight Princess: Ilia and Epona

ZD writes: Twilight Princess is a story of tragic love. Love that was too weak to repel darkness. Love whose nature opposed itself, forcing eternal separation. Love that preserved through countless generations a hope of great reunion, but lost all meaning. The restoration of the young girl Ilia’s memories is often counted as a great triumph in the love shared between her and Link, but that is also a tragedy. Its tragedy comes from eclipsing another story, a deeper tragedy. This story haunted Ilia through her seemingly joyful time with the hero, though only one could know the source of her deep sadness and loss – feelings Ilia didn’t even realize she had.

Twilight Princess’ Hyrule Field Is Boring, Empty, And Excellent

TheGamer Writes "In my experience, The Legend of Zelda: Twilight Princess’ once-warm reception has chilled somewhat over the years. Praised at launch as a beautiful return to form after the “childish” art style of its direct predecessor, the world eagerly embraced a game that more closely followed Ocarina of Time’s famous structure and plot cues. Perhaps most alluringly of all, the grandeur and sheer scope of this reimagined Hyrule Field wowed millions of us."
